2023 Research Intern, Wireless Communications and Sensing Systems

Lab Summary: The Standards & Mobility Innovation team is committed to developing technologies that enable ubiquitous access to information and provide immersive multimedia experiences for mobility users.  Our research focuses on:

  • Wireless standards and technology including Wi-Fi, 5G, LTE-A, IoT
  • RF & fast prototyping of 5G and IEEE 802 wireless systems and/or use cases
  • Multimedia standards and technology including VR, HDR, All-IP delivery.

Position Summary:  Join SMI lab of Samsung Research America in Plano, Texas to contribute to the R &D of the IEEE 802.11, 802.15 or 5G based communication or sensing systems design and prototyping.

Responsibilities:

 In this position, the incumbent will involve in one or more of the following activities:

  • Wireless sensing
    • Investigate new approaches and signal processing/machine learning algorithms for Wi-Fi/mm Wave/UWB sensing (including active/passive radar)
  • Indoor positioning
    • Develop indoor positioning technologies based on IEEE 802.11 or 802.15 next generation wireless system
  • Next-generation communications
    • Assist in algorithm design and analysis based on PHY/MAC layers of IEEE 802.11 and 3GPP 5G NR technologies
    • Develop necessary simulators for IEEE 802.11 wireless systems or 5G cellular network to evaluate algorithm designs
  • General
    • Develop prototypes of potential solutions
    • Perform system performance analysis and problem diagnosis
    • Involve in the development of related IPR(s)

Skills/Experience

  • Sound technical background in signal processing, machine learning, wireless communication systems and algorithms, and measurable familiarity with IEEE 802.11,802.15 standards or 3GPP LTE/NR standards.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ills to effectively represent the derived results and technical concepts developed in the course of the work.
  • Ability to work within Samsung in cross-functional, cross-divisional teams.
  • Hands-on MATLAB, C++, Python coding skills.
  • PhD student preferable or equivalent combination of education, training, and experience.
